You have an on-premises datacenter and an Azure subscription.
You plan to connect the datacenter to Azure by using ExpressRoute.
You need to deploy an ExpressRoute gateway. The solution must meet the following requirements:
- Support up to 10 Gbps of traffic.
- Support availability zones.
- Support FastPath.
- Minimize costs.
Which SKU should you deploy?
A. ERGw1AZ
B. ERGw2
C. ErGw3
D. ErGw3AZ
Answer
A. ERGw1AZ
Explanation
To meet the stated requirements, the ExpressRoute gateway SKU must support:
- Up to 10 Gbps of throughput
- Availability zones for high availability across datacenter failure domains
- FastPath to bypass the ExpressRoute gateway and reduce latency
- Minimizing costs
Let’s evaluate each SKU option:
ERGw1AZ:
- Supports up to 10 Gbps bandwidth
- Supports availability zones
- Supports FastPath
- Least expensive AZ-enabled SKU
ERGw2:
- Supports up to 10 Gbps
- Does not support availability zones
- Supports FastPath
- Less expensive than ErGw3 but lacks AZ
ErGw3:
- Supports up to 10 Gbps
- Does not support availability zones
- Supports FastPath
- More expensive than ERGw2 without adding AZ
ErGw3AZ:
- Supports up to 10 Gbps
- Supports availability zones
- Supports FastPath
- Most expensive SKU
In summary, the ERGw1AZ SKU provides 10 Gbps throughput, availability zone support, and FastPath capability while having the lowest cost of the AZ-enabled SKUs. Therefore, ERGw1AZ is the best choice to meet all of the stated solution requirements.
